X-Men '97 Delivers Nostalgic Finale with Fresh Take on Classic Costumes
The animated series concludes its first season on Disney+ with a nod to its comic book origins and a playful critique of past film adaptations.
- X-Men '97 finale features a humorous take on the franchise's costume evolution, contrasting the iconic colorful suits with the black leather of earlier films.
- Fans and critics alike praise the series for balancing nostalgia with innovative storytelling, highlighting its success in reinvigorating the X-Men franchise.
- The finale's trailer sparked discussions about the evolution of superhero costumes, emphasizing the shift from muted to vibrant representations.
- The series finale, titled 'Tolerance is Extinction,' promises intense action and deep narrative arcs, reflecting on themes of acceptance and survival.
- X-Men '97 has been renewed for a second season, indicating strong viewer engagement and positive reception.
